First one is MIN w/Santana sitting at -108 right now for Pinny bettors. Santana has only been below -130 once this season, against OAK he won as a -118 dog. Santana is 30-5 (+22.1 Units) against the money line in night games over the last 2 seasons. The other hurler for this game, Mark Buehrle has 14 earned runs in his last four starts. He also has a four-game losing streak going against the Twins. Lastly looking at the Bullpen, the Twins relievers have posted a 1.54 ERA in their last three compared to Chicago?s 5.49 through that span.

Second one is SFO w/Lowry, Pinny has them currently at -102. The San Fran southpaw has four shutouts in his last six outings and lasted at least seven innings in three of those performances. Looking at his last three starts he has a 1.83 ERA and has not given up a home run. Meanwhile the big red machine is only batting .237 vs. Lefty's in their last 10 games. Cincy is probably feeling good w/Hudon on the hill since the team has won the last four that he has started. However three of those four wins came by only one run, with the only blowout coming against the Padres.

Buehrle should be pretty sharp tonight (tho ump may mess him up).

He typically is very sharp at home after some bad road outings. In those last four starts you mentioned he had one at home (vs Seattle with 1 run/er in 7 innings).

He has 1.96 era at home (0.99 whip), with team record of 9-3 in those starts. Plus, his team has 6-3 record at home in his starts vs MN last three seasons.

I'd love the under after 5 innings in this game if we had a better ump.
